body {
	margin:0;
	background: url(images/beijing.jpg) repeat-x #fff;
	text-align:center;
	font-size:12px;
}
.clear{ clear:both;}
#container{ width:1000px; margin:0 auto;}
#tmenu{ height:33px; background:url(images/menubg.gif) 0 -33px repeat-x; overflow:hidden;}
#tmenu .left{ float:left; width:8px; height:33px; background:url(images/menubg.gif) left 0 no-repeat}
#tmenu .right{ float:right; width:8px; height:33px; background:url(images/menubg.gif) right 0 no-repeat}
#tmenu ul{ list-style:none; margin:0px; padding:0px; text-align:right;} 
#tmenu ul li{ float:left; height:33px; font-size:13px; font-weight:bold; margin:0 6px;}   
#tmenu ul li a { text-decoration:none; float:left; height:33px; color:#fff; font-size:14px; padding:0px 5px; line-height:35px;}
#tmenu ul li a:hover{ color:#333; background:url(images/menubg.gif) 0 -107px no-repeat;}
#tmenu ul li.menul{ width:10px; padding:0px;}
#tmenu ul li.menur{ width:0px; padding:0px;}
#tmenu ul li.search{ margin-left:60px;}
#tmenu ul li.line{ background:url(images/menubg.gif) 0 -68px no-repeat; width:5px; margin:0 3px;}

#top01{
	height:92px; 
	margin:auto;
	border-top:3px solid #0051a0;
}
#top01 .logo {
	width:434px; 
	height:63px;
	display:block;
	margin-top:15px;
	float:left;
}
#top02{
	width: 565px;
	height: 15px;
	float: right;
	margin-top: 20px;
	font-size: 12px;
	text-align: right;
}
#top03{
	width: 565px;
	height: 22px;
	float: right;
	margin-top: 10px;
	font-size: 15px;
	text-align: right;
	font-family: "微软雅黑";
}
#top03 a{ color:#03c;}
p{margin:0; padding:0}
a:link,a:visited{text-decoration:none;color:#333;}
a:hover{color:#f00; text-decoration:none;}
/*---内容样式---*/
#container #Tbody{ width:100%; margin:0 auto; text-align:left;}
/*---主内容--*/
.classlink a:link,.classlink a:visited{font-size:13px; color:#0066FF;}
.classlink a:hover{font-size:13px; color:#f00;}
.linkus{margin-bottom:5px; height:23px; background:url(images/link_bg.GIF) no-repeat; line-height:23px; text-indent:68px; color:#FF0000;}
#bigContentBox{padding:8px 0 20px 0;}/*-没有左右栏的大内容-*/
#bigContentBox #Content{ margin:15px 0 15px 15px; table-layout:fixed; word-break:break-all; overflow:hidden; text-align:left; line-height:200%; font-size:14px;}
#sidebar{ float:left; width:200px; margin-top:15px; border-right:1px dotted #b7b7b7;}
#innersidebar{}
#mainContent{ margin:15px 0 0 210px;}/*-右边内容-*/
#innermainContent{}

.txtbox{ margin:8px 0 15px 0;}
.cate{ background:#ededed; height:17px;}/*分类导航*/
.cate span{ float:right; width:30px; line-height:17px;}
.cate span a:link,.cate span a:visited{ font-size:12px; color:#666;}
.news ul{ list-style:none; margin:0; padding:0;}
.news ul li{ height:24px; line-height:24px; overflow:hidden; border-bottom:1px dotted #ddd; color:#999;}
.news ul li span{ float:right; width:40px; color:#999;}
.news ul li.pic{ margin:2px; height:160px; border:1px solid #ddd;}
.news ul li.pic img{ margin:2px; border:0; width:220px; height:156px;}
.news ul li.end{ border:0;}

.lianxi{ margin:0 0 15px 0; padding:0;}
.lianxi li{ list-style:none;}
.lianxi img{ border:0;}

/*当前位置*/
.c_nav{ background:url(images/nav_bg.gif) right 9px no-repeat; height:25px; line-height:25px;}
.c_nav span{ float:left; display:block; padding:0 10px 0 0; background:#fff;}
.c_nav2{ background:#f2f2f2; height:25px; line-height:28px;}
.c_nav2 span{ float:left; display:block; padding:0 10px 0 0; background:url(images/gsfenlei.gif) no-repeat; text-indent:35px; font-size:15px; font-weight:bold; color:#fff;}


.lm{ background:url(images/gsfenlei.gif) no-repeat; height:30px; line-height:32px; overflow:hidden; text-indent:34px; font-size:14px; font-weight:bold; color:#fff;}
.lmlist { margin:0;}
.lmlist ul{ margin:10px; padding:0; list-style:none;}
.lmlist ul li{ list-style:none; background:url(images/dhbg2.gif) center no-repeat; height:31px; line-height:31px; margin-top:4px; text-indent:10px; text-align:center}
.lmlist ul li.selected{ background:#ddd; background:url(images/dhbg3.gif) center no-repeat; font-weight:bold;}
.lmlist ul li a:link,.lmlist ul li a:visited{ display:block; width:100%; height:31px; font-size:14px; color:#fff;}
.lmlist ul li a:hover{color:#ff0; background:url(images/dhbg.gif) center no-repeat;}
.lmlist ul li.selected a{ font-weight:bold;}

.curcate{ margin-left:10px; height:30px; line-height:30px; background:#f2f2f2; text-indent:10px; font-size:14px; color:#666;}

#sidebar-top{background:url(images/yj_side_1.gif) no-repeat; height:12px; font-size:1px;}
#sidebar-content{width:100%; background:url(images/yj_side_2.gif) repeat-y; margin:0; padding:0;}
#sidebar-bottom{background:url(images/yj_side_3.gif) no-repeat; height:12px; font-size:1px;}
/*首页产品*/
.product-box ul{ float:left; list-style:none; margin:5px; padding:0px; width:160px; height:162px; text-align:center;}
.product-box ul li{ padding:2px; text-align:left;}
.product-box ul li.pimg{ width:155px; height:125px; margin:2px; overflow:hidden; border:1px solid #ddd; text-align:center}
.product-box ul li.pimg img{ border:0;}
.product-box ul li.ptitle{ line-height:18px; text-align:center;}
.product-box ul li.pnote{ height:18px; line-height:18px; color:#666;}
.product-box ul li a:link,.product-box ul li a:visited{color:#333;}
.product-box ul li a:hover{color:#f00;}
/*产品列表*/
.cplist ul{ float:left; width:48%; border-bottom:1px solid #f2f2f2; list-style:none; margin:5px; padding:0px; height:140px; text-align:center;}
.cplist ul li{ padding:2px; text-align:left;}
.cplist ul li.pimg{ float:left; width:155px; height:125px; margin:2px; overflow:hidden; border:1px solid #ddd; text-align:center}
.cplist ul li.pimg img{ border:0;}
.cplist ul li.ptitle{ line-height:18px;}
.cplist ul li.pnote{ height:18px; line-height:18px; color:#666;}
.cplist ul li a:link,.product-box ul li a:visited{color:#333;}
.cplist ul li a:hover{color:#f00;}

.channel ul{ list-style:none; margin:0; padding:0;}
.channel ul li{ color:#666; line-height:180%; font-size:12px;}
.channel ul li.pic{ margin:5px 0;}
.channel ul li.pic img{ border:0;}
.channel ul li a:link,.channel ul li a:visited{ color:#03c;}

.yqlink{ background:#ededed url(images/linkbg.gif) no-repeat; height:80px;}
.yqlink .list{ margin:40px 0 0 0; text-align:center;}

#footer{ clear:both; height:90px; text-align:center; line-height:20px; background:url(images/dh021.jpg) repeat-x;}
#footer p{ margin-top:15px;}
#linkbox{margin-left:12px; margin-right:10px;}
.menutop{height:34px; line-height:34px; background:url(images/index_tab_bg_1.gif) no-repeat; text-align:center; font-size:14px; color:#993300; font-weight:bold;}
.links{width:100px; height:22px; line-height:22px; float:left; overflow:hidden;}
.links a:link,.links a:visited{color:#666;}
.links a:hover{color:#0a8e05; background:#fff;}
#productBox{margin:10px; padding:10px; background:#ffefd9; border:1px solid #faad2d; line-height:150%; width:150px; float:right; font-size:13px;}
/*用户中心菜单栏*/
#usercenter{margin:0 5px 5px 5px;}
#usercenter ul{list-style:none; margin:0px; padding:0px;}
#usercenter ul li{padding:5px; text-align:center; border-bottom:1px dotted #ccc;}

.tdbgcolor { width:111px; height:34px; line-height:34px; text-align:center; background-image:url(images/titlebg.gif); background-repeat:no-repeat;font-size:15px; font-weight:bold; color:#FFFFFF}
TD{
font-family: 宋体;
font-size: 12px;
line-height: 15px;
}
td.TableBody1
{
border-left:1px solid #21A6E6;
background-color: #FFFFFF;
}
.tableBorder
{width:760px;
background-color:#FFFFFF;
border-left:8px solid #3182AB;
border-right:1px solid #21A6E6;
}
.tableBody
{
border-left:1px solid #A9A9A9;
border-right:1px solid #A9A9A9;
color:#000000;
}
.fontstyle1
{font-size:15px; font-weight:bold; color:#FFFFFF}
.SmallLine {background-image:url(Images/smallline.GIF); background-position:center; background-repeat:repeat-x}
.SmallLine2 {background-image:url(Images/smallline.GIF); background-position:bottom; background-repeat:repeat-x}
.tdBody1
{
color:#CCCCCC;
background-color: #006699;
}
th{
height:26px;
margin:center;
color:#666666;
background-color: #E8E8E8;
font-family: 宋体;
font-size: 13px;
}
	td.leftfont { color:#666666; }
	td.leftfont A { color:#000000; TEXT-DECORATION: none;}
	td.leftfont A:hover { COLOR: #0000FF; TEXT-DECORATION: underline;}
.tableBorder1
{
width:97%;
background-color: #F0F0F0;
}
.table { border-collapse: collapse; border-left: 1px solid #000000; border-right: 1px solid #000000; background-color:#ffffff }
INPUT{BORDER-TOP-WIDTH: 1px; PADDING-RIGHT: 1px; PADDING-LEFT: 1px; BORDER-LEFT-WIDTH: 1px; FONT-SIZE: 9pt; BORDER-LEFT-COLOR: #cccccc; BORDER-BOTTOM-WIDTH: 1px; BORDER-BOTTOM-COLOR: #cccccc; PADDING-BOTTOM: 1px; BORDER-TOP-COLOR: #cccccc; PADDING-TOP: 1px; HEIGHT: 18px; BORDER-RIGHT-WIDTH: 1px; BORDER-RIGHT-COLOR: #cccccc}
.btn{ border:0; background:url(images/dh015.jpg) left top no-repeat; width:52px; height:19px; line-height:25px; font-weight:bold;}
.sh_box{width:166px; height:17px; background:url(images/dh016.jpg) 0 0; border:0; color:#666; line-height:18px; text-indent:3px}
